A lovely restaurant with an outside patio in the shadows: Restaurant Aurora (9. August 2022)

Somehow I never really consciously realized the Aurora – although I have had events there, I was somehow not aware of the restaurant per se although seeing it when walking by many times. Still, I’m always looking for new restaurants I haven’t tried yet, I decided to give the Aurora a try. I went for the “cold cucumber soup with cucumber ice cream” (CHF 16.00) which was truly refreshing, and a nice change compared to the regular summer gazpachos you get in so many restaurants.

As a main, I went for the “Milk Lamb Rack (lemon gremolata, pomegranate)” (CHF 54.00) which was a massive portion! It did not only look big, it was actually a big plate. And a tasty one – the quality of the meat was great, the lamb is nicely rose and full of flavour. So, truly a delicious main.

The “creamy leave spinach” (CHF 7.00) was interesting in thus far as that it was served in some kind of curry sauce, providing it with a nice and interesting flavour profile.

The “risotto with Parmesan cheese” (CHF 7.00) was smooth, creamy, and tasty. It was a bit too dense for my personal gusto, but still enjoyable.

The place is also lovely because you get to sit outside in the shadows, which allows you to relax outside and chill even when everything around is soaring hot since the area is covered by the shadow of the surrounding trees. The waitress was friendly and swift – only when it came to settling the bill, it took much longer than with everything else, making it a bit annoying. Other than that, I can recommend the Aurora – good dishes, lovely setting, but not necessarily on the cheap side.
